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Florida Oranges vs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ds:
100 calories of Florida Oranges have 2.7 times more Vitamin C and 4.5 times more Vitamin E than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ds.
While 100 kcal of Raw sprouted alfalfa seeds contain 1.5 times more Vitamin A, 1.5 times more Vitamin B1, 6.3 times more Vitamin B2, 2.4 times more Vitamin B3, 4.5 times more Vitamin B5, 1.3 times more Vitamin B6, 4.2 times more Vitamin B9 and more Vitamin K than Raw Florida Oranges.
100 calories of Florida Oranges have insufficient amounts of Vitamin K
100 calories of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ds have insufficient amounts of Vitamin E
Both Raw Florida Oranges as well as Raw sprouted alfalfa seeds have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 100 calories.
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Florida Oranges vs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ds:
100 kcal of Raw sprouted alfalfa seeds contain 1.5 times more Calcium, 8.1 times more Copper, 21.3 times more Iron, 5.4 times more Magnesium, 15.7 times more Manganese, 11.7 times more Phosphorus, 2.4 times more Selenium, 23 times more Zinc and 2.1 times more Water than Raw Florida Oranges.
Both Florida Oranges and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ds contain similar levels of Potassium per 100 calories.
100 calories of Florida Oranges lack sufficient amounts of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
100 calories of Florida Oranges have 2.7 times more Carbohydrate and 22.9 times more Sugars than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ds.
While 100 kcal of Raw sprouted alfalfa seeds contain 6.6 times more Fat, 31.8 times more Omega 3, 15.1 times more Omega 6, 1.6 times more Fiber and 11.4 times more Protein than Raw Florida Oranges.
Both Florida Oranges and Sprouted Alfalfa Seeds offer comparable quantities of Energy per 100 calories.
100 calories of Florida Oranges prov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3 and Omega 6
